Sandton Hotel PillowsStationsweg 9, 8011 Zwolle, Pays Bas.Situated in the centre of the lively hanseatic city Zwolle, the luxury Sandton Hotel Pillows is housed in the stately police station that dates back to 1850. Sandton Hotel Pillows has been decorated with the authentic style and atmosphere of the building in mind and, as the name suggests, has been richly furnished with beautiful, soft materials that add a tasteful and modern character to the whole interior. Located along the sophisticated station road in Zwolle (Stationsweg), Hotel Pillows is suitable for both business and leisure guests that greatly value atmosphere, personal attention and comfort. The hotel offers 44 spacious, air conditioned rooms, provided with all the luxuries imaginable. Every day, the team chooses a nice wine to accompany the wine menu. Zwolle is a lively province city that still clearly shows traces from the Middle Ages. You can go on a city tour on foot along historic buildings and sights. Alternatively, you can take a ride in a boat, pedalo or canoe through the city's canals. In the city centre you can wonderfully stroll along shops, cafés and restaurants. The surrounding area of Zwolle also has a lot to offer, such as Giethoorn, known as the Dutch Venice, Schokland, a former island of the Zuider Zee, or the gardens of Mien Ruys in Dedemsvaart. The historical towns Kampen (with its historic town centre), Hattem (Anton Pieck) and Elburg are also well worth visiting. Overijssel is well-known for its landscape with wide lakes, forests and romantic castles and manors; all the more reason to hop on a bike or go hiking.
